Warning Signs You Need Hail Damage Restoration

Hail can cause damage that isn’t always immediately obvious, especially to the untrained eye. Recognizing these warning signs early can save you a significant amount of money and prevent more serious issues from developing. Pay attention to your home’s exterior and interior after any significant storm. Early detection makes a big difference in the complexity and cost of repairs.

Dents on Siding and Gutters

Observe your home’s exterior for visible dents or dings on vinyl siding, metal gutters, or downspouts. These marks are direct indicators of hail impacts. Visual inspection is your first line of defense against hidden damage.

Cracked or Missing Shingles

Carefully inspect your roof for shingles that are cracked, chipped, or completely missing. Granules from asphalt shingles found in your gutters or downspouts also signal damage. Shingle integrity is crucial for your roof’s protective function.

Damaged Window Screens or Frames

Hail can leave small punctures or tears in window screens and even chip paint or dent window frames. Check these areas closely for any signs of impact. Protecting your windows is essential for keeping the elements out.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Any new water stains appearing on your interior ceilings or walls, especially near windows or skylights, could indicate a roof leak caused by hail. Interior water marks are a critical alert that something is wrong. Don’t ignore these.

Compromised Flashing or Vents

Areas around roof penetrations like vents, chimneys, and skylights have metal flashing. Hail can bend, crack, or loosen this flashing, creating entry points for water. Secure flashing prevents leaks around vulnerable spots.

Unusual Noises from the Roof

After a hailstorm, listen for any new creaking or popping sounds coming from your roof or attic. These noises might indicate shifting or structural stress from the impact. Auditory clues can sometimes signal underlying issues.

Hail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or cosmetic dents on a metal shed Yes, if you’re comfortable with minor repairs and have the right tools. No Usually superficial and doesn’t affect functionality.
A few cracked or missing shingles on a low-slope roof Maybe, if you have experience and can safely access the area. Yes Roof integrity is critical; a small problem can become a big leak.
Significant roof shingle damage across a large area No Yes Requires specialized knowledge, equipment, and safety protocols for proper repair.
Dents on vinyl siding that don’t compromise the material Yes, for minor cosmetic touch-ups. No Often a cosmetic issue that doesn’t impact the siding’s protective function.
Cracked or broken siding panels No Yes Damaged siding allows water infiltration and compromises your home’s insulation.
Visible water stains or active leaks inside your home No Yes Indicates a breach in the exterior, requiring immediate professional attention to prevent mold and structural damage.

While minor cosmetic issues might be tempting to handle yourself, any damage that affects your home’s structural integrity or ability to protect you from the elements should be handled by professionals. Hail Damage Restoration Cost In Aledo, TX

The cost of hail damage restoration can vary significantly depending on the extent of the damage, the size of your property, and the specific materials affected. These price ranges are estimates for work in Aledo, TX and surrounding areas. Accurate pricing requires an on-site assessment by our team. Local conditions can also influence material and labor costs.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Roof Shingle Replacement (per square foot) $5 – $15 Type of shingle, complexity of roof design, and extent of damage.
Siding Repair/Replacement (per linear foot) $10 – $30 Type of siding material (vinyl, fiber cement, etc.) and the size of the affected area.
Gutter Repair/Replacement (per linear foot) $8 – $20 Material (aluminum, steel, vinyl) and the need for new downspouts.
Window Screen Repair/Replacement $50 – $150 per screen Size of the screen and the quality of the replacement material.
Emergency Tarping $300 – $800 Size of the damaged roof area requiring temporary coverage.
Full Roof Replacement (due to severe hail) $8,000 – $25,000+ Size of the roof, pitch, complexity, and type of roofing material selected.
